Physicochemical quality of drinking water has a direct impact on consumer health and fluoride, nitrite, nitrate, total dissolved solids compounds and pH are their important parameters that have closely relationship with community health. In many cases, source nitrate of water is due to agriculture activities, landfill sites and also potassium nitrate that used in the manufacture of glass, nitrite in form of sodium nitrite used as a food preservative too. Also there are different levels of fluoride in natural waters and its high concentration is usually found in very vast geographic areas in the belt deposits, volcanic and granitic rocks. Adverse amount of these compounds in water can cause a variety of diseases including met-hemoglobinema, skeletal and dental inelegance, Down syndrome and reduce IQ (Intelligence Quotient) [1].
